Large-format wall tiles

Large-format wall tiles
It’s time to say goodbye to the old-fashioned mosaic tiles on your bathroom walls and say hello to a more modern design. Large-format tiles take the area by storm, and you don’t want to be left out. This trend is attractive because it impacts space by displaying few grout lines with fewer breaks, producing a much cleaner look. These large tiles come in various colors and textures, giving an ideal setting for authentic materials.

Back-lit mirrors and medicine cabinets

Back-lit mirrors and medicine cabinets
Backlit mirrors and medicine cabinets are an outstanding choice for your modern bathroom remodeling. The mirror design provides adequate lighting for your bathroom without adding extra reflections and glares. Also, the design creates a glowing effect and subsequently gives the illusion of a floating mirror, making your bathroom look classy and eye-catching.

Warm colors and durable paints

Painting your bathroom a new color goes a long way in freshening it up. Choosing a warm color is ideal if you’re looking to create a calm, peaceful environment, and the vibrant color goes a long way in helping you feel fresh and renewed every morning. Irrespective of the color you choose, you should pick durable paint to help keep your bathroom clean for a long time. One of the best choices is PPG UltraLast paint + primer, which is resistant to mildew and makes it crucial to enhancing your bathroom interior.

Quartz countertops

Quartz countertops
You don't have to compromise on the quality of your bathroom remodeling material when you have the opportunity to choose the best. Quartz is a natural material resistant to scratching and staining and was deemed the best countertop material in  NKBA’s 2021 bathroom trends report.

Wood-look tiles and heated flooring

Wood-look tiles and heated flooring
Your bathroom deserves high-ranking wood and tiles for flooring, and so do you. Porcelain and ceramic are the best choices to help bring your bathroom to the next level. These materials are versatile and offer many other exceptional benefits, like resistance to moisture, bacteria, and more.
